Energy - Training Coordinator
You will be required to manage and schedule safety, technical and operational training for our Energy Business Unit site and functional colleagues, ensuring compliance to align with accredited awarding bodies.
Using our in-house CMS (Competency Management System) you will be responsible for maintaining accurate training records, coordinating with our internal trainers and external providers, advice and support projects on the correct qualifications for all site roles, support individual career development, and manage project training costs
Key Responsibilities
Training Coordination & Scheduling: Plan and organise internal and external training sessions, ensuring all personnel are adequately qualified and competent for a variety of roles
Compliance & Records Management: Maintain meticulous records of certifications, cards, competencies, ensuring compliance with health and safety standards and customer requirements.
Resource & Provider Management: Source and quality check external training providers, negotiate dates, locations and costs ensuring excellent quality training and cost-effective delivery.
Needs Assessment & Development: Assess training requirements across all Energy projects, developing site-specific training materials and workshops.
Stakeholder Liaison: Work closely with site management, project managers, supervisors and the customer to identify skill gaps and schedule necessary training.
Advice and Support: Work with individuals and projects to identify requirements and advice the best route to gain the required competency.
Early Talent Support: Source additional operational, safety and technical training for apprentices, graduates, and placement students.
Required Skills and Qualifications
Knowledge of the Energy Industry: The ideal candidate should have awareness and understanding of the infrastructure energy industry, health & safety regulations, accredited awarding bodies (e.g., CITB, CSCS/CPCS), network authorisations etc.
Organisational Skills: Excellent planning and multitasking abilities, with high attention to detail for audit purposes.
Communication: Strong interpersonal skills for liaising with site teams, subcontractors, internal and external training providers.
Technical Proficiency: Competence in Microsoft Office Suite and experience with Learning Management Systems (LMS) or HR systems.
Experience
Previous experience in training coordination, HR, or learning and development within the infrastructure sector is typically required, but training and support will be provided to assist your development in the role.

About the Energy Business Unit
We have extensive experience in upgrading and replacing energy networks, delivering asset management for major UK energy companies and network operators.
Our transmission and distribution services involve the upgrading and replacement of electricity assets both above and below ground. Within the electricity sector we install and maintain assets, including excavation, laying, and jointing of cables, (fluid filled and XLPe), substations and overhead line, new build, repair, and refurbishment services.
